Automotive Weatherstripping: Engineering Factors

In order to design automotive parts that stay competitive, it's important to understand some details behind automotive weatherstripping. Weatherstripping (or weatherseals) is the system that seals any openings in a vehicle to keep out weather conditions. The word is also used to describe the actual materials used to implement these sealing systems.

Weatherstripping (and other sealing solutions) are used for all sorts of automotive applications. They are needed wherever the interior compartment of an automobile or other form of transportation needs to be sealed from the environment. The material you use needs to integrate and function well with the body design of the vehicle.

Engineering Factors for Automotive Weatherstripping

An important factor to consider when selecting material for automotive weatherstripping is the engineering of the parts. Let's take a look at several engineering factors.

1. Functionality

Whether the vehicle is operating at full speed or parked, the weatherstripping must maintain full functionality.

2. Flexibility

Also, weatherstripping must be flexible enough to address vibrations caused by vehicle movement.

3. Temperature Exposure

The material used must be able to handle subzero temperatures. Conversely, it must be able to tolerate extreme heat and extensive exposure to the sun.

4. Liquid Exposure

Of course, auto weatherstripping should also withstand liquids including gasoline, oil, and methanol (windshield washer fluid). Bumps and vibrations cause movement between the body of a vehicle and movable parts like windows and doors. This movement might cause water to penetrate the vehicle. Weatherstripping must be applied to seal the gap.

5. Noise Reduction

Another important factor to keep in mind is that weatherstripping can play a part in keeping noise out of the passenger compartment, which impacts ride quality. Similar to how the movement between body and movable parts mentioned above causes water to enter, the movement can also cause noises like rattles, squeaks, and creaks to pollute the passenger compartment.

Automotive Weatherstripping Sizes

If we consider a standard four-door vehicle, we can get an idea of weatherstripping size requirements. Each door would need at least 20 feet of material. Every window would require at least 10 feet of material. Trunks would need much larger amounts of material, due to how much more space it needs to seal.

Automotive Weatherstripping Materials

Automotive weatherstripping is usually made of these materials:

  • Thermoplastic elastomer (TPV) mix of plastic and rubber
  • Thermoplastic olefin (TPO) polymer/filler blend
  • Silicone (for sunroofs to endure extreme heat)
  • EPDM rubber

Coating Benefits

Weatherstripping performance can be optimized with the application of specialty coatings. Of course, the coating applied must sufficiently adhere to the material used to manufacture the weatherstripping. When the proper coating is chosen and bonds to the weatherstrip, it can offer several benefits such as:

  • Reduced force needed to open/close doors (by decreased static of friction)
  • Resistance to ultraviolet rays and chemicals
  • Eliminated or decreased noise

Is OEM Weatherstripping Better Than Aftermarket?

When you need to replace the weatherstripping on your Toyota, you face an important question. Should you get OEM weatherstripping, or would aftermarket weatherstripping do just fine? It's actually a question you should ask every time you replace an auto part.

If you ask us, OEM is always better. OEM weatherstripping is a much better investment than aftermarket weatherstripping for two reasons:

  1. Material quality
  2. Fitment

The Importance Of Material Quality

The reason your car is loaded with weatherstripping is simple. Weatherstripping keeps your car's interior clean, dry, and comfortable. For the weatherstripping on your car to be effective, it needs to be made with high quality materials.

That's where OEM weatherstripping comes in. Toyota makes a point to manufacture its weatherstripping with high quality rubber, adhesives, and clips. With OEM weatherstripping on your car, you'll know that it will last a long time.

You don't have the same guarantee with aftermarket weatherstripping. Many aftermarket manufacturers use low quality materials to cut corners:

  • Low quality rubber can become brittle in extreme weather. This leads to cracks and breakage, which defeats the purpose of the part.
  • Low quality adhesive won't stay on the car for long. You'll be left with loose weatherstripping that can't serve its purpose.

The Importance Of Fitment

When it comes to weatherstripping, fitment is everything. For weatherstripping to work optimally, it needs to:

  • Be the right length
  • Have the right thickness
  • Have clips and holes that line up with the vehicle's attachment points

In that case, you can't go wrong with OEM weatherstrips. OEM stands for original equipment manufacturer. If you buy OEM weatherstripping, you're getting an exact replica of the weatherstripping already on your car. Fitment is never an issue.

Aftermarket manufacturers design their weatherstripping to their own discretion. They don't have to follow OE specs. That's why many aftermarket weatherstrips don't fit well. It's not uncommon to encounter the following issues with aftermarket weatherstripping:

  • Leaking doors, windows, and/or sunroof
  • Shorted out electrical parts (due to the weatherstripping failing to keep moisture out)
  • Doors not closing correctly
